Inflar error Z Buf

Errores de computadoras

Preguntas frecuentes sobre zlib. Inflar error Z Buf Inflar error Z Buf

objetivo c - Z_BUF_ERROR -5 al intentar descomprimir ...

https://stackoverflow.com/questions/13868211/z-buf-error-5- while-trying-to-decompress-zlib-data

Z_BUF_ERROR se explicará más adelante, pero basta con decir que esto es simplemente una indicación de que inflate () no podría consumir más entrada o producir más salida. inflate () se puede llamar de nuevo con más espacio de salida o más entrada disponible, que estará en este código. Algunos de los errores que veo:

"Inflar" de ZLib devuelve el código -5, "error de búfer". Ahora que ...

http://codeverge.com/embarcadero.delphi.rtl/zlib-s-inflate-returns-code-5-buffer-e/1070145

Tenga en cuenta que Z_BUF_ERROR no es fatal, e inflate () se puede llamar nuevamente con más entrada y más espacio de salida para continuar descomprimiendo. Si se devuelve Z_DATA_ERROR, la aplicación puede llamar a inflateSync () para buscar un buen bloque de compresión si se desea una recuperación parcial de los datos. Supongo que la envoltura de Delphi ZLIB se está rindiendo demasiado pronto.

Preguntas frecuentes sobre zlib

http://www.zlib.net/zlib_faq.html

deflate () o inflate () devuelve Z_BUF_ERROR. Antes de realizar la llamada, asegúrese de que avail_in y avail_out no sean cero. Al establecer el parámetro flush igual a Z_FINISH, también asegúrese de que avail_out sea lo suficientemente grande como para permitir el procesamiento de todas las entradas pendientes.

Ejemplo de uso de zlib

https://zlib.net/zlib_how.html

Z_DATA_ERROR indica que inflate () detectó un error en el formato de datos comprimidos zlib, lo que significa que, para empezar, los datos no son un flujo zlib o que los datos se corrompieron en algún momento desde que se comprimieron.

Archivo de origen zlib.h

https://homes.cs.washington.edu/~suciu/XMLTK/xmill/www/XMILL/html/zlib_8h-source.html

No se proporciona salida. 00577 00578 inflateSync devuelve Z_OK si se ha encontrado un punto de descarga completo, Z_BUF_ERROR 00579 si no se proporcionaron más entradas, Z_DATA_ERROR si no se ha encontrado ningún punto de descarga, 00580 o Z_STREAM_ERROR si la estructura de la secuencia era inconsistente.

[SOLUCIONADO] Ignorando Z_BUF_ERROR con avail_in == 0 ...

https://forum.cfx.re/t/solved-ignoring-z-buf-error-with-avail-in-0/1010774

10 de julio de 2020 · [SOLUCIONADO] Ignorando Z_BUF_ERROR con avail_in == 0. Desarrollo y modificación de recursos de FiveM. Discusión. ayuda, z_buff_error, avail_in. IROSTICK. 31 de mayo de 2020, 9 ... Es un tipo de error de carga corrupto, lo que sea que haya intentado generar y da ese error, vuelva a instalarlo y asegúrese de que se lleve toda la memoria (verifique el tamaño de los archivos antes de cargar y ...

desinflar error al usar git · Edición # 10 · jtkukunas / zlib ...

https://github.com/jtkukunas/zlib/issues/10

15 de octubre de 2014 · Parece que -5 corresponde a Z_BUF_ERROR. ¿Está su árbol disponible públicamente para que pueda investigar esto más a fondo? Git usa dos opciones de configuración para controlar el nivel de compresión de desinflado, core.loosecompression y pack.compression.

inflar

https://refspecs.linuxbase.org/LSB_3.0.0/LSB-Core-generic/LSB-Core-generic/zlib-inflate-1.html

Z_BUF_ERROR. No es posible ningún progreso; avail_in o avail_out era cero. Z_MEM_ERROR. Memoria insuficiente. Z_STREAM_ERROR. El estado (como se representa en la secuencia) es inconsistente o la secuencia era NULL. Z_NEED_DICT. Se requiere un diccionario preestablecido. El campo adler se establecerá en la suma de comprobación Adler-32 del diccionario elegido por el compresor.

biblioteca de compresión de propósito general zlib versión 1.1.3

http://koeln.ccc.de/archiv/drt/zlib-manual.html

compress2 devuelve Z_OK si tiene éxito, Z_MEM_ERROR si no hay suficiente memoria, Z_BUF_ERROR si no hay suficiente espacio en el búfer de salida, Z_STREAM_ERROR si el parámetro de nivel no es válido. int descomprimir (Bytef * dest, uLongf * destLen, const Bytef * fuente, uLong sourceLen); Descomprime el búfer de origen en el búfer de destino.

Fecha actualización el 2021-07-27. Fecha publicación el 2021-07-27. Categoria: computadoras Autor: Oscar olg Mapa del sitio Fuente: errorsbase